2nd shift Sander

**Summary**

This position requires product be sanded to work instructions and / or customer print specifications utilizing a variety of manual or powered tools. All products must meet or exceed quality standards and may require special handling. This position requires dexterity along with attention to detail.

**Essential Duties and Responsibilities**
- Assist Production Lead and Material Handler in EOR (End Of Run) & EOS (End Of Shift) reporting.
- Recognize, validate, and resolve discrepancies in reporting (count, weight, location, batch, etc.)
- Assist and train other associates in creating labels, scanning bar codes, and any other task to monitor and ensure accurate inventory control.
- Perform prestaging of next job at the press by supplying all supporting equipment and documentation (fixtures, jigs, tools, work instructions, cooling racks, etc.)
- Perform press reset after a production run is complete by inspecting and returning all supporting items back to their home locations (fixtures, jigs, tools, work instructions, cooling racks, etc.)
- Responsible for training all operators on their shift and utilize training sheet FM-2-005 to validate that the associate has been trained and understands the work instructions.
- Train all associates on the proper use and technique required for all tools issued.
- Demonstrate how to complete any/all secondary operations while still maintaining an acceptable quality level.
- Instruct and monitor the use of tools utilized to trim parts for flash, gates, etc as per part work instructions.
- Train and demonstrate assembly, packing, and labeling of product that is done at the machine along with how to capture and dispose of discrepant scrap product.
- Training on the process to setup and execute hot iron insertion of inserts into components at the press when applicable.
- Review common defects associated with product and ensure that the associate can recognize and understand possible discrepancies (flash, sinks, splay, shorts, etc.)
- Assist production with relief for breaks and operating equipment when needed.
- Must follow all safety and work instructions along with completion of all required documentation.
- Maintains an open line of communication to assure all problems and changes are communicated and resolved in a timely manner.
- As requested, assist other team members in cross-training and conduct on the job training of other associates.
- Actively participates in Continuous Improvement teams and activities, including 5S & housekeeping. Facilitate and support facility and manufacturing safety, environmental and ergonomics efforts.
- Additional responsibilities as assigned by manager.
